My favorite part of this animation is the constant motion of everything. Nothing ever looks like it's completely still. It's something that most animations (particularly Game Grump animations) lack. It's a breath of fresh air to see a Game Grump / OneyPlays animation that's not just a slide show with a sound track in the background.

The puppet style is also really nice; it's unique to you and pleasant to look at. Also, the Clutch Cargo-esque scene in the middle and the Bart scene at the end add more depth to the animation. Most Game Grump Animated videos I see are just '13-year-old learns Flash' style of animation. I'm glad you actually put effort into your cartoon by thinking outside the box.

I honestly have no idea why people are giving this down votes. This is what cartoons should look like: grotesque objects in fluid motion. It's (unfortunately) something most people don't do on the Internet.

In summation: keep it up! I expect the same top-notch quality from your future works!

It's nice to see an animation with fluidity and not just be a collection of stills. It's also nice to see an animation with an interesting art style like this. I can see your influences right away (He-Man, JoJo's Bizarre Adventure, etc.) and it makes me happy that animators still care about making unique art styles and not just chibi shit.

There are a few weird pacing issues, a couple of missed visual jokes, and the 'Plz Sub' thing at the end could've be emitted from the Newgrounds release, but this is an excellent video overall. It's pleasing to both the eye and the ear. It's also worth countless replays.

Hope this isn't just a one-off animation, because I'd like to see more of your work in the future.

HochiganMeat responds:

thanks! best review I've ever had. Very helpful. I agree, I should've left the ending out, I actually forgot about it. I'll update it when I can.
And yes, the pacing issues come from my audio editing skills- I'm going to work on that in the future definitely. I've only just learned about timing sheets, so that will be an eye opener when I get back into it.
More animation to come- just need to find a way of working that keeps everything visually coherent. Plus there's life stuff and all the rest of it, etc. Thanks for watching, this made my day xx
